Deep, super dark brown coloured body, with a large, super soapy head, two to three centimetres tall that has large bubbles, but fades quickly. Aroma of rye (of course), nuts, specialty grains, some yeast, bread, earth and rustic funk along with a touch of dry hay. Medium-bodied; Strong caramelised sugar flavours dominate with a lot of grass and dryness from all the malts, with a definite rye, nut and earthy profile that shows the flavours from the rye, but also the nuanced complexities from the simple ingredient. Aftertaste is mellow and very sweet with the caramel, toffee and earth really showing up way more than any hops, alcohol or yeast - this is about caramelised sugars and deep rye grain, and it does it well! Overall, a nice and robust rye based ale that has a ton of flavour, especially considering the low alcohol, all with a good bite and smooth sugar profile. I sampled this twelve ounce can purchased from Whole Foods in Arlington (Pentagon City), Virginia on 20-May-2020 for US$1,99 sampled at my house here in Washington on 20-July-2020, exactly two months later.
